conventional trailer aerodynamic trailer

Clear improvement of the aerodynamics by reduction of the vortexin the rear end (by boat tail shape)

CD reduction by boat tailing the trailerTo realize by elongation of the trailer length

VariantsLength Change

Front & Rear

Paletts [1m Height]

Volume [98 m³] const.Fuel Reduction

[Easy highway]

Basis TGX 0%

Front :+ 0,8 m

Rear : 0- 5%

Front :+ 0,8 m

Rear : + 0,6 m- 8%

Front :+ 0,8 m

Rear : + 1,2 m- 10%

Front :+ 0,8 m

Rear : + 2,7 m- 15%
